The delivery service programme explained briefly:

As a business owner, you run your DSP company, often with 20 to 40+ vans and 30 to 70+ drivers. Amazon provides the essentials to start your business at a distribution centre. You are then responsible for building your business, plus selecting and building a powerful team of dedicated drivers.

The benefits of setting up your own delivery business in partnership with Amazon, at a glance:

· Getting started - Benefit from various offers, such as delivery vans with the Amazon logo, comprehensive insurance, industrial-quality portable devices and other services.

· Training offered - We offer our Delivery Service Partners the opportunity to take part in various training courses and learn from our logistics expertise.

· Amazon technologies - We provide you with a range of tools and technologies to keep your business running smoothly.

· Low start-up costs - Out of a total of £25,000 of liquid funds required, you usually only need £10,000 to cover your initial investment costs.
